Describe ONE specific detail that illustrates Jefferson's vision in the early republic(1783-1800)

History
1 answer:
sleet_krkn [62]3 years ago
8 0
Thomas Jefferson envisioned the republic as an agricultural based economy with a weak central government. He wanted the power to be within the hands of the people

The people who formed a five-nation confederacy in the Northeast were whom?
lianna [129]
A. The Iroquois

The Iroquois Confederacy was a political and social organization located in New York and parts of northwestern Pennsylvania. It included the Mohawk, Oneida, Cayuga, Onondaga, and Seneca tribes. The Tuscarora later became a 6th member.
